【技術實現步驟摘要】
進行域名解析的方法和裝置
本專利技術涉及計算機
,特別涉及一種進行域名解析的方法和裝置。
技術介紹
隨著網絡技術的不斷發展,通過網絡獲取信息已成為人們獲取信息的主要途徑,人們可以使用終端通過某網站的網絡地址,開啟該網站的網頁,人們可以在該網頁中獲取相應的信息。在使用終端通過網絡地址開啟某網頁的過程中,需要對網絡地址進行域名解析處理,具體地,終端中預先設置有DNS(DomainNameSystem,域名系統)服務器的IP(InternetProtocol,網絡之間互連的協議)地址,用戶在瀏覽器的地址欄中,輸入某網站的網絡地址(可以稱為目標網絡地址),如www.1234.com,輸入完成后,用戶點擊確認按鍵,觸發終端獲取地址欄中的目標網絡地址,發送給DNS服務器,DNS服務器中存儲有網絡地址與IP地址的對應關系,DNS服務器接收到目標網絡地址后,在上述對應關系中查找,得到目標網絡地址對應的IP地址,DNS服務器將得到的IP地址發送給終端,然后,終端通過該IP地址向該網站的服務器發送網頁數據獲取請求,服務器將相應的數據發送給終端。在實現本專利技術的過程中,專利技術人發現現有技術至少存在以下問題:通過上述方法對網絡地址進行域名解析處理的過程中,如果DNS服務器出現故障,例如,DNS服務器停止工作,則終端將無法獲取到該網頁的網絡地址對應的IP地址,而只能等待DNS服務器恢復正常,從而,使得進行域名解析的靈活性較差,影響了服務的可用性。
技術實現思路
為了解決現有技術的問題,本專利技術實施例提供了一種進行域名解析的方法和裝置。所述技術方案如下:第一方面,提供了一種進 ...
【技術保護點】
一種進行域名解析的方法,其特征在于,所述方法包括:如果通過預設的域名系統DNS服務器在對目標網址中的目標域名進行域名解析時發生錯誤,則終端獲取預先設置的域名轉換服務器的網絡互連協議IP地址;所述終端通過所述IP地址,向對應的域名轉換服務器發送攜帶有目標域名的域名解析請求;所述終端接收所述域名轉換服務器發送的攜帶有所述目標域名對應的IP地址的反饋消息。
【技術特征摘要】
1.一種進行域名解析的方法,其特征在于,所述方法包括:如果通過預設的域名系統DNS服務器在對目標網址中的目標域名進行域名解析時發生錯誤,則終端獲取預先設置的域名轉換服務器的網絡互連協議IP地址,所述預設的域名系統DNS服務器在對目標網址中的目標域名進行域名解析時發生錯誤為預設的域名系統DNS服務器發生故障,或者,所述DNS服務器對目標網址中的目標域名進行域名解析后,得到錯誤的網絡互連協議IP地址;所述終端通過所述IP地址,向對應的域名轉換服務器發送攜帶有目標域名的域名解析請求;所述終端接收所述域名轉換服務器發送的攜帶有所述目標域名對應的IP地址的反饋消息;所述域名解析請求中還攜帶有所述終端的IP地址,所述域名轉換服務器用于在接收到所述終端發送的所述域名解析請求時,確定所述終端的IP地址對應的第一網絡類型,并根據預先存儲的域名、網絡類型與IP地址的對應關系,確定所述第一網絡類型和所述目標域名對應的IP地址,所述網絡類型用于表示不同網絡運營商提供的網絡。2.根據權利要求1所述的方法,其特征在于,所述終端接收所述域名轉換服務器發送的攜帶有所述目標域名對應的IP地址的反饋消息之后,還包括:在所述目標網址中,所述終端將所述目標域名替換為接收到的IP地址,發送攜帶有所述目標網址的數據訪問請求。3.一種進行域名解析的方法,其特征在于,所述方法包括:域名轉換服務器接收終端發送的攜帶有目標域名的域名解析請求;其中,所述域名解析請求是所述終端通過預設的域名系統DNS服務器在對目標網址中的目標域名進行域名解析時發生錯誤時,通過預先設置的所述域名轉換服務器的網絡互連協議IP地址,向所述域名轉換服務器發送的請求,所述預設的域名系統DNS服務器在對目標網址中的目標域名進行域名解析時發生錯誤為預設的域名系統DNS服務器發生故障,或者,所述DNS服務器對目標網址中的目標域名進行域名解析后,得到錯誤的網絡互連協議IP地址;所述域名轉換服務器根據預先存儲的域名與網絡互連協議IP地址的對應關系,確定所述目標域名對應的IP地址;所述域名轉換服務器向所述終端發送攜帶有確定出的IP地址的反饋消息;所述域名解析請求中還攜帶有所述終端的IP地址,所述域名轉換服務器根據預先存儲的域名與IP地址的對應關系,確定所述目標域名對應的IP地址,包括:所述域名轉換服務器確定所述終端的IP地址對應的第一網絡類型;所述域名轉換服務器根據預先存儲的域名、網絡類型與IP地址的對應關系,確定所述第一網絡類型和所述目標域名對應的IP地址,所述網絡類型用于表示不同網絡運營商提供的網絡。4.根據權利要求3所述的方法,其特征在于,所述方法還包括:所述域名轉換服務器按照預設的更新周期,向預設的域名系統DNS服務器發送攜帶有第二域名的域名解析請求;所述域名轉換服務器接收所述預設的DNS服務器發送的攜帶有所述第二域名對應的IP地址的反饋消息;如果本地存儲的所述第二域名對應的IP地址與接收到的IP地址不同,則所述域名轉換服務器使用接收到的IP地址替換本地存儲的所述第二域名對應的IP地址。5.一種終端,其特征在于,所述終端包括:獲取模塊,用于如果通過預設的域名系統DNS服務器在對目標網址中的目標域名進行域名解析時發生錯誤,則終端獲取預先設置的域名轉換服務器的網絡互連協議IP地址,所述預設的域名系統DNS服務器在對目標網址中的目標域名進行域名解析時發生錯誤為預設的域名系統DNS服務器發生故障,或者,所述DNS服務器對目標網址中的目...
【專利技術屬性】
技術研發人員:胡建強,郭稷,廖玉榮,李丹,
申請(專利權)人:廣州華多網絡科技有限公司,
類型:發明
國別省市:廣東;44
還沒有人留言評論。發表了對其他瀏覽者有用的留言會獲得科技券。